K.C.'s Medical Home Care Supplies, Inc. is a Medicare and Medicaid Participating Durable Medical Equipment (DME) Provider established in 1988.

Our company provides medical services to patients in a number of counties in the North and Central Georgia area. Office hours are 9:00am – 5:00pm Monday through Friday. With an after-hours answering service, DME technicians, and respiratory therapists on call 24 hours a day and 365 days a year to serve our patients.

All of our staff are licensed or certified and are required to attend regular industry accepted or accredited certification programs to maintain their level of proficiency. Extensive inservice training is also provided to improve our staff's familiarity with company specific policies/procedures and new information related to their field(s) of expertise.

Our General Office and Warehouse is located at 100 Etowah Trace in Fayetteville, Georgia 30214. This facility contains a 5000 square-foot warehouse and offices equipped with state of the art technology. At present, we have ten permanent employees on staff: two respiratory therapists, four DME technicians servicing and delivering equipment, two licensed pharmacist, a consulting physician, a warehouse manager, a billing department, and front office receptionists.

Getting Started
  • The patient must be actively under a medical doctor’s care, a doctor of osteopathy, or a doctor of podiatry.
  • The patient must have current insurance coverage under Medicare, Medicaid, Workman’s Compensation, a private health insurance, or be classified as a private payer.
  • The doctor has to certify the need for services. This is accomplished when we receive a written signed order confirming the services.
  • A home assessment for environment safety for home care services must then be completed.

Referrals
  • Your medical doctor needs to send KC Medical a written and signed order.
  • Your order can be:
    • Called in to our office at 770-716-7678
    • Faxed to our office at 770-716-1814
    • And some of our patients bring their orders in to our office from their doctor’s office
  • After we receive the order, our trained in-take personnel will make follow up calls to your medical doctor for verification purposes.
